GOME_L1_EXTRACTED
Variables
The table below lists the variables that are present in the HARP product that results from an ingestion of GOME_L1_EXTRACTED data.
| field name | type | dimensions | unit | description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| datetime_stop | double | {time} | [seconds since 2000-01-01] | time of the measurement at the end of the integration time |
| datetime_length | double | {time} | [s] | length of each measurement |
| orbit_index | int32 | absolute orbit number | ||
| latitude | double | {time} | [degree_north] | tangent latitude of the measurement |
| longitude | double | {time} | [degree_east] | tangent longitude of the measurement |
| latitude_bounds | double | {time, 4} | [degree_north] | corner latitudes for the ground pixel of the measurement |
| longitude_bounds | double | {time, 4} | [degree_east] | corner longitudes for the ground pixel of the measurement |
| wavelength_photon_radiance | double | {time, spectral} | [count/s/cm2/sr/nm] | measured radiances |
| wavelength_photon_radiance_uncertainty | double | {time, spectral} | [count/s/cm2/sr/nm] | absolute radiance measurement error |
| wavelength | double | {time, spectral} | [nm] | nominal wavelength assignment for each of the detector pixels |
| integration_time | double | {time, spectral} | [s] | integration time for each pixel |
| scan_subindex | int8 | {time} | relative index (0-3) of this measurement within a scan (forward+backward) | |
| scan_direction_type | int8 | {time} | scan direction for each measurement; enumeration values: forward (0), backward (1) | |
| solar_zenith_angle | double | {time} | [degree] | solar zenith angle at instrument |
| solar_azimuth_angle | double | {time} | [degree] | solar azimuth angle at instrument |
| viewing_zenith_angle | double | {time} | [degree] | line of sight zenith angle at instrument |
| viewing_azimuth_angle | double | {time} | [degree] | line of sight azimuth angle at instrument |
| index | int32 | {time} | zero-based index of the sample within the source product |
Ingestion options
The table below lists the available ingestion options for GOME_L1_EXTRACTED products.
| option name | legal values | description |
|---|---|---|
| band | band-1a, band-1b, band-2a, band-2b, band-3, band-4, blind-1a, straylight-1a, straylight-1b, straylight-2a | only include data from the specified band (‘band-1a’, ‘band-1b’, ‘band-2a’, ‘band-2b’, ‘band-3’, ‘band-4’, ‘blind-1a’, ‘straylight-1a’, ‘straylight-1b’, ‘straylight-2a’); by default data from all bands is retrieved |
| data | sun_reference | retrieve the measured radiances (default) or the sun spectra (data=sun_reference) |

Mapping description
GOME Level 1 Extracted Spectra
The table below details where and how each variable was retrieved from the input product.
| field name | mapping description | |
|---|---|---|
| datetime_stop | path | /egp[]/agi/groundpixel_end |
| datetime_length | description | set to fixed value of 1.5 [s] |
| orbit_index | path | /pir/start_orbit |
| latitude | path | /egp[]/agi/coords[4]/latitude |
| description | tangent latitude of the measurement | |
| longitude | path | /egp[]/agi/coords[4]/longitude |
| description | tangent longitude of the measurement | |
| latitude_bounds | path | /egp[]/agi/coords[0:3]/latitude |
| description | The corners are rearranged in the following way: 1,3,2,0 | |
| longitude_bounds | path | /egp[]/agi/coords[0:3]/longitude |
| description | The corners are rearranged in the following way: 1,3,2,0 | |
| wavelength_photon_radiance | path | /egp[]/brda[]/edr[]/abs_radiance |
| description | will be set to NaN is brda record is not available or if egp[]/brda[]/edr[]/flag != 0 | |
| wavelength_photon_radiance_uncertainty | path | /egp[]/brda[]/edr[]/abs_rad_err |
| description | will be set to NaN is brda record is not available or if egp[]/brda[]/edr[]/flag != 0 | |
| wavelength | path | /egp[]/brda[]/edr[]/wavelength |
| integration_time | path | /egp[]/brda[]/integration_time |
| scan_subindex | path | /egp[]/sub_counter |
| description | if a measurement consisted of multiple ground pixels, the subset counter of the last pixel is taken | |
| scan_direction_type | path | /egp[]/sub_counter |
| description | the scan direction is based on the subset counter of the measurement; 0-2: forward (0), 3: backward (1) | |
| solar_zenith_angle | path | /egp[]/agi/solar_angles_spacecraft/zenith_b |
| solar_azimuth_angle | path | /egp[]/agi/solar_angles_spacecraft/azimuth_b |
| viewing_zenith_angle | path | /egp[]/agi/los_spacecraft/zenith_b |
| viewing_azimuth_angle | path | /egp[]/agi/los_spacecraft/azimuth_b |
